This cover is great if you want to automate your BIQU B1 to run 24/7! You will also need to: -Use my part ejector which bolts to the print head: https://www.thingiverse.com/thing:4999862 -Use a bed clearing script at the end of your G-code (or for OctoPrint users, use the 'continuous print' plugin). Mine is listed at the end of this text. -Change your start G code to prime off the edge of the bed to prevent build up of filament. Mine is listed at the end of this text. This particular model covers the Y axis belt, so that parts do not get jammed in there when they are automatically ejected. The two halves are connected using two 6mm x 30mm wooden dowels. Once assembled a flat platform is created which allows the parts to slide off easily. As it sits very close to the heated bed, I would recommend using PETG to prevent warping. Bed Clearing Script: M140 S0 ;turn off heated bed G4 S1800 ;wait for 30 mins M17 ;enable steppers G90 ;back to absolute positioning G28 X Y ;home XY G1 X119 Y238 F6000 ;move to centre back G1 Z1 F2000 ;move Z down G1 Y40 F1000 ;eject G1 Y238 F6000 ;return to back G1 X79 F6000 ;move left -40 G1 Y40 F2000 ;eject G1 Y238 F6000 ;return to back G1 X159 F6000 ;move right +40 G1 Y40 F2000 ;eject G1 Y238 F6000 ;return to back G1 X39 F6000 ;move left -80 G1 Y40 F2000 ;eject G1 Y238 F6000 ;return to back G1 X199 F6000 ;move right +80 G1 Y40 F2000 ;eject G1 Y238 F6000 ;return to back Start G-code Script (THIS USES UBL LEVELLING!!! You may need to change it!): ; BIQU B1 Start G-code M117 Heating Bed and Nozzle M140 S{material_bed_temperature_layer_0} ; Set Heat Bed temperature M104 S{material_standby_temperature} ; Set Nozzle temperature M190 S{material_bed_temperature_layer_0} ; Wait for Heat Bed temperature G92 E0 ; Reset Extruder M117 Homing G28 ; Home all axes M117 3 Point Plane Probing G29 A G29 L1 G29 J M117 Heating Nozzle M104 S{material_print_temperature_layer_0} ; Set Extruder temperature G1 Z2.0 F3000 ; Move Z Axis up little to prevent scratching of Heat Bed G1 X0 Y0 F5000.0 ; Move to bottom left corner G1 Z0.0 F5000.0 ; Move to Z0 M109 S{material_print_temperature_layer_0} ; Wait for Tool temperature G92 E0 ; Reset Extruder M117 Purging G1 E30 F300 ; Purge off the side of the bed G92 E0 ; Reset Extruder ;G1 E{-retraction_amount} F{retraction_speed} ; Retract by users settings G1 X15 F300 ; Move onto bed to wipe nozzle G1 Z0.2 F3000 ; Move Z Axis up little to prevent scratching of Heat Bed M117 Beginning Print
